Show Notes:

In this episode of The Chicks Who Give a Hoot podcast, Sara kicks off a mini-series leading up to the launch of her first book, 'Do It Fat: An Unapologetic Guide to Taking Up More Space Regardless of Your Size,' releasing on November 18th. This episode dives into the book's central themes around body positivity, visibility, and dismantling weight-based stigma. The host shares personal stories and insights, offers a sneak peek of her favorite book excerpts, and previews several chapters, including 'Save Your Sorrys' and 'The Goalpost Keeps Moving.' Listeners are invited to upcoming book launch events and encouraged to embrace their bodies as they are today.
